发布于: Nov 14, 2023

AWS Lambda 控制台现在通过与 AWS 应用程序编辑器集成来支持两项新功能,使开发人员可以轻松地以可视化方式或通过基础设施即代码 (IaC) 构建无服务器应用程序。首先,开发人员现在可以在控制台上配置函数时查看和下载该函数的 AWS Serverless Application Model (AWS SAM) 模板。其次,只需单击一个按钮,他们即可将其 Lambda 函数导出到 AWS 应用程序编辑器,同时保留所有函数配置。

此次发布后,开发人员可以使用函数概览页面上的模板视图来查看代表其函数当前配置(包括触发器和目的地)的 IaC 模板。他们还可以下载此模板以继续在首选 IDE 中进行编辑。想要使用 AWS 应用程序编辑器的可视化构建器功能的开发人员可以将其函数从 Lambda 控制台导出到应用程序编辑器控制台,从而根据其 Lambda 函数的配置创建新的无服务器应用程序项目。他们可以通过以可视化方式组合其应用程序架构,将其函数与各种受支持的 AWS 服务关联,继续将该项目发展成一个完整的无服务器应用程序。

在 Lambda 控制台上查看 SAM 模板并将函数的配置导出到 AWS 应用程序编辑器的功能已在提供应用程序编辑器的所有区域推出。

要开始使用,请按照 AWS Lambda 文档中的将 Lambda 与基础设施即代码 (IaC) 配合使用教程进行操作。